Witness / Karen Hesse.

By: Hesse, KarenMaterial type: TextTextPublication details: New York : Scholastic Press, 2001Edition: 1st edDescription: 161 p. : ports. ; 20 cmISBN: 0439271991 (hc); 0439272009 (pb)Subject(s): Ku Klux Klan (1915- ) -- Juvenile fiction | Prejudices -- Juvenile fiction | Vermont -- Juvenile fictionGenre/Form: Novels in verse. DDC classification: [Fic] LOC classification: PZ7.H4364 | Wk 2001Summary: A series of poems express the views of various people in a small Vermont town, including a young black girl and a young Jewish girl, during the early 1920s when the Ku Klux Klan is trying to infiltrate the town.
